One of the most prominent manifestations of blockchain-based earnings is within the realm of Decentralized Finance, or DeFi. DeFi leverages blockchain technology to recreate traditional financial services – lending, borrowing, trading, insurance – without relying on centralized institutions. Within DeFi, individuals can earn passive income in a multitude of ways. Staking, for instance, involves locking up a certain amount of cryptocurrency to support the operations of a blockchain network. In return for this service, stakers are rewarded with new tokens, essentially earning interest on their digital assets. This is a powerful concept for those looking to grow their wealth beyond traditional savings accounts, offering potentially higher yields, albeit with associated risks.
Yield farming is another popular DeFi strategy where users provide liquidity to decentralized exchanges (DEXs) or lending protocols. By depositing their crypto assets into liquidity pools, users enable others to trade or borrow. In return, they receive a share of the trading fees and often additional reward tokens, which can be highly lucrative. While yield farming can offer impressive returns, it's also one of the riskier DeFi ventures, with complexities like impermanent loss and smart contract vulnerabilities to consider. Understanding the nuances and conducting thorough research are paramount before diving into these opportunities.

Non-Fungible Tokens (NFTs) have become a cornerstone of this revolution. NFTs are unique digital assets that represent ownership of a specific item, whether it's a piece of digital art, a collectible, a piece of music, or even a virtual land parcel in a metaverse. Creators can mint their work as NFTs and sell them directly to their fans, bypassing traditional galleries, publishers, and record labels. This not only allows them to capture a larger share of the revenue but also enables them to embed royalties into the smart contracts of their NFTs. This means that every time the NFT is resold on a secondary market, the original creator automatically receives a predetermined percentage of the sale price, creating a continuous stream of income.

The concept of "play-to-earn" gaming is another exciting frontier where blockchain-based earnings are taking shape. In these games, players can earn cryptocurrency or NFTs by achieving in-game milestones, completing quests, or participating in competitive events. These earned assets can then be traded on marketplaces or used within the game economy, creating real-world value from virtual activities. Axie Infinity, for instance, gained immense popularity by allowing players to earn its native cryptocurrency by breeding, battling, and trading digital creatures called Axies. This model democratizes gaming, turning what was once solely a recreational activity into a potential source of income, particularly for individuals in developing economies.
The underlying technology that facilitates these earning mechanisms is the smart contract. These are self-executing contracts with the terms of the agreement directly written into code. They run on the blockchain and automatically execute actions when predefined conditions are met, without the need for intermediaries. For example, a smart contract can be programmed to automatically release payment to a freelancer once a client confirms the completion of a project, or to distribute royalties to artists every time their NFT is resold. This automation and trustless execution streamline processes, reduce administrative overhead, and ensure that agreements are honored reliably.

Consider the burgeoning world of Web3, the next iteration of the internet, built on decentralized technologies. In Web3, users are not just consumers of content; they are active participants and owners. This ownership model is directly linked to earning potential. Many Web3 platforms reward users with native tokens for their engagement. This could be as simple as reading articles on a decentralized news platform, contributing to discussions on a social media site, or providing data to decentralized applications. These tokens can then be traded for other cryptocurrencies or fiat currency, effectively turning online activity into a direct source of income. Brave browser, for example, rewards users with its Basic Attention Token (BAT) for viewing privacy-respecting ads, a stark contrast to traditional browsers where ad revenue primarily benefits the platform.
This concept of rewarding user engagement is also reshaping social media. Imagine a Twitter-like platform where users earn tokens for creating popular content, curating feeds, or even for simply engaging with posts through likes and comments. Platforms like Steemit and Hive have already pioneered this, allowing users to earn cryptocurrency for publishing and curating content. While these platforms have faced their own unique challenges and evolving ecosystems, the underlying principle – that user-generated value should be rewarded – is a powerful testament to the potential of blockchain-based earnings. It fosters a more collaborative and rewarding online community where everyone has a vested interest in the platform's success.
